Structuring a knowledge-based maritime cluster: contributions of network analysis in a tourism region

Abstract

The notion of maritime cluster encompasses a diversity of activities from fi sheries, aquaculture, transports to coastal tourism or even science-based activities. This article debates the possibilities to consolidate the maritime cluster as one of the driving forces of the Algarve, a Portuguese region internationally recognized by tourism. This cluster did not emerge spontaneously and several policy initiatives to promote its formalization were being developed. The regional actors are not sure about the organizations that can be mediators in the cluster.
